Household or garden waste can be dropped off in-between waste collection days at any of the City’s 20 drop-off facilities.
Up to 1 300kg (1,3 tons) of non-hazardous waste may be disposed at any of these sites, at no cost. Green garden waste is then chipped and composted, while builder’s rubble is crushed for re-use.
Some drop-off sites also provide facilities for recycling of residential special waste such as tins, glass, paper, plastics, oil and electronic waste (such as old computers and cell phones). Waste that is not recyclable or re-useable is then transported to the landfill for disposal.
The Athlone drop-off facility accepts Garage waste, clean garden waste, motor oil, cans and metal, paper, cardboard, glass bottle, plastic, clean builders rubble.
